Osbourne Court is the modern residential care home that sits right next door to the St Michael’s Centre on North Road in Stoke Gifford.

Once a month, on a Sunday afternoon, we gather there with residents, their families and carers for a simple act of worship together. Our service includes hymns, testimony, a short talk and some prayers.

We also offer a simple communion service at Osbourne Court on a Thursday morning – usually the second Thursday of the month at 11.00am.

Details of particular dates and times will be made available to residents in the care home.

The Link Club is a friendly fortnightly gathering for ladies over retirement age.  We meet for conversation and refreshments, and there is usually a speaker as well.

We meet alternately in Stoke Gifford and Little Stoke – hence the name Link Club – because we link the two ends of the parish.

Twice a year we have a coach outing together, once in the summer and once at new year, for a meal.

Monday Men is an informal social group that meets once a week in St Michael’s Centre for friendship, conversation, support and a listening ear when required. We are generally of retirement age, but the group is open to anyone.
